    Hi I have the self sufficiency household cleaning book (just got it very excited!) and for a shampoo recipe for in carpet cleaning machines they recommend 4-5 tsp liquid castile soap or dishwashing liquid in 9 litres of hot water and add 4 and 1/2 tsp of borax or soda crystals (to the whole 9 litres)
    I havent tried this so dont know but hope it helps
